Beitragvon Social Orphan » Di Nov 13, 2007 4:46 pm

Hi, update on getting Saga videos on my ipods I was able to get my first video on my ipod...Don't be Late. I used Avstoyou. I DO NOT recommend it. It is supposed to be free but you get the words 'Non-activated version AVSTOYOU" in red appearing in the middle of the screen most of the video. Then you also get s smushed together picture. It worked good, so I checked into what I needed to do to activate it and it cost $30 for one year......for unlimited time $70. I said forget that.,...that is crazy for some product from some manufacturer I never heard of. Would fee more comfortable purchasing Quicktime Pro. Still anyone know of any free products to convert and import videos to my ipod let me know. Thanks.
